Youth Girls train with the Swans

With the inaugural Youth Girls Nationals only two weeks away, Illawarra and Sydney members of the NSW/ACT team fine tuned their preparations by training with the Sydney Swans at the SCG on Tuesday.

Swans players Nick Malceski, Ed Barlow and Gary Rohan put the girls through their paces by undertaking goal kicking practice before playing a game with the players.

It was a fantastic opportunity for the girls to hear firsthand what is required to play AFL at the highest level and to learn a few tricks of the trade from the players.

Not only did the girls train with the Swans but they were also given a rare tour of the historic SCG’s training facilities.

The team was taken to the club’s change-room where they admired the names on the lockers of some of the legends of the game including Tony Lockett, Paul Kelly and Bob Skilton.

As part of the tour the girls were taken through the medical room, warm-up area and the ice bath players’ use for recovery.

The Youth Girls NSW/ACT team will continue their preparations for the inaugural Youth Girls Nationals being held in Melbourne from September 7 to 11.
